Clearance issues that I have discovered are the inner wheel well fender where it attaches to the side fender. I have zero offset wheels. As it stands now, my rears are 20x12 and with zero offset, centered in the rear wheel well, I can get one index finger between the bed fender and the outer sidewall of the tires...its about the same out front too. I ended up removing my front fendewell and fabricating my own. Most people don't have front inner fenders or they swap them out for trailer fenders when dropped lower than 3 inches up front.
